I have a Kodak DX3215 which I use regularly to photograph items that I sell on e-bay and other online auction sites.
The great benefit of this camera is that it is so easy to transfer images from the camera straight to your PC through the handy docking station which came with it . No fuss, no hassle, just place the camera in the dock and the pictures are zapped to your PC straight away. For a technophobe like me, that's a real boon.
It's also great ... ...The macro function for taking crystal clear close-up shots is a real winner.
The disadvantages of the camera include a very poor flash mechanism which lead to variable picture quality results. Also, although it is a small irritation, there's no lens cover cap and no way to fit one, leading to difficulties in keeping it clean and the danger of scratching or damaging the lens. It's also a bit bulky compared to others on the market.

Camera flash
Camera Flash: Built-in flash
Flash Modes: Fill-in mode, auto mode, flash OFF mode, red-eye reduction
Red Eye Reduction: Built-in
Effective Flash Range: 0.5 m - 2.7 m
Lens system
Type: Zoom lens - 4.5 mm - 9 mm
Focal Length: 4.5 mm - 9 mm
Focal Length Equivalent to 35mm Camera: 30 - 60mm
Focus Adjustment: Focus free
Min Focus Range: 75 cm
Macro Focus Range: 25-80cm
Optical Zoom: 2 x
Zoom Adjustment: Motorised drive
Lens Construction: 7 group(s) / 8 element(s)
Features: Built-in lens shield
Additional features
Self Timer: Yes
Additional Features: Auto power save, date/time stamp, DPOF support
Viewfinder
Viewfinder Type: Optical - real-image zoom

Want to get into digital with ease? You've found your camera. Kodak EasyShare DX3215 camera gets you started with 1.3-megapixel CCD (1280 x 960 picture resolution) for great prints. A 4x zoom (2x optical and 2x digital) lets you get closer to the fun. It's the perfect camera to get you into digital picture taking. Great pictures made simple. It's true, all you have to do is press a button. That's how easy it is. And what's even easier is how quickly you'll be able to capture your favorite moments. With 8MB of internal memory, you'll never miss a shot. And with the DX3215's MultiMediaCard/Secure Digital memory card (MMC/SD) expansion slot, you'll have plenty of memory to keep on shooting with optional MMC/SD memory cards. If you use the Kodak EasyShare Camera Dock, sharing is just as easy. Simply place your DX3215 in the dock, touch the button, and pictures are automatically sent to your computer ready for e-mailing and printing. The Camera Dock will also recharge your camera's battery pack, so you'll always be ready to take more pictures.
